Output 8db66c79712c09ed401076cb1c2a94918f2e53aa3ce24f16e1308daa1defdd1d:1

value
680664
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33c186a8fa4cf73d7a6b5f6d30d4aac8e838270a OP_EQUAL
address
36QgDkUfrTfWbJ19mPMCHRKXBzpL8rrKSU
transaction
8db66c79712c09ed401076cb1c2a94918f2e53aa3ce24f16e1308daa1defdd1d